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8958628 1650472021 0280598372
788064 23410374936
788064 23410374936
73639684786 4378363 164522035 04
All about undefined
Interested in learning more?
788064 23410374936
73639684786 4378363 164522035 04
See more
228 620989985
1134 77797 358
See more
8133 505074190 0885174461
642 239241203 0402 919547 484
See more